Insulin (any) Drug Interactions
33Total Interactions
2Severe
7Moderate
0Mild
| Drug | Severity | Summary |
|---|---|---|
| Clarithromycin | SEVERE | Clarithromycin has been reported to cause hypoglycaemia when given with Insulin. Manufacturer adv... |
| Metreleptin | SEVERE | Metreleptin is predicted to increase the risk of hypoglycaemia when given with Insulin. Manufactu... |
| Bezafibrate | MODERATE | Bezafibrate is predicted to increase the risk of hypoglycaemia when given with Insulin. Manufactu... |
| Ciprofibrate | MODERATE | Ciprofibrate is predicted to increase the risk of hypoglycaemia when given with Insulin. Manufact... |
| Fenfluramine | MODERATE | Fenfluramine might decrease blood glucose concentrations when given with Insulin. Manufacturer ma... |
| Fenofibrate | MODERATE | Fenofibrate is predicted to increase the risk of hypoglycaemia when given with Insulin. Manufactu... |
| Gemfibrozil | MODERATE | Gemfibrozil is predicted to increase the risk of hypoglycaemia when given with Insulin. Manufactu... |
| Somapacitan | MODERATE | Somapacitan might increase blood glucose concentrations, opposing the blood glucose-lowering effe... |
| Somatrogon | MODERATE | Somatrogon might increase blood glucose concentrations, opposing the blood glucose-lowering effec... |
